Default NSS vs GBH vs V'A

I'm not heralding this as particularly scientific but I wanted to get a feel for the parse potential of each of my three main choices of 1H. The V'A in question is the fabled version not mythical!

So, using spectres in SS, I ran a series of autoattack only fights in my regular tanking gear and compared the results.

NSS [1129,805,1159] Mean 1031
GBH [927, 771, 872] Mean 857
V'A [992, 921, 991] Mean 968

The better spread of the NSS seems to win through. From my perspective I always felt I parsed fractionally better with the GBH when I didn't have extra DPS or haste buffs but this doesn't look to be the case.

It has also stirred me into action to find an upgrade to NSS, since there are better 1Hers out there. And it looks like I'll still bring out my Soulfire Gladius for the tough fights.


As I said, this is hardly very scientific but I thought I'd share anyway.

Default Re: NSS vs GBH vs V'A

Assuming you have 70% DA and 45% melee crits before equipping the weapons here are the calculations:

Vel'Arek will do 108.466 DPS
Carotidcutter will do 105.94 DPS
GBH will do 105.783 DPS
NSS will do 101.597 DPS

Thus, Vel'Arek is the best of those choices. Thus if you have Vel'Arek, it's the best weapon you can have. Carotidcutter and GBH are basically equal, while NSS falls slightly behind.

Your test is hugely flawed because how crits are calculated against grey mobs, thus giving a HUGE advantage to the NSS.
